  7. Lectrotruck repair and partial restoration.

    THE LEAD SCREW: The lead screw was completely caked in black grease and dirt. The original manual calls for WD-40 periodically and the modern manual calls for a PTFE dry lubricant spray NOT WD40 as it quickly evaporates. both manuals say NOT to grease the screw as it collects dirt and clogs the...
